I've been playing with some old photos including scans I did from around the time I got my first computer. That scanner was the HP PhotoSmart. Far surpassed in quality by everything else later on but it was a revelation to me at the time, making prints of my color photos without a lab.
From 10/1999. City of Rocks State Park, New Mexico. Near sunset. Original photo was done with Velvia film, Canon A2E (EOS 5) camera and a 20-35mm Canon lens.
Black & grey conversion in Lightroom from original scan.
